WebHemophilia Description Hemophilia is a bleeding disorder that slows the blood clotting process. People with this condition experience prolonged bleeding or oozing following an injury, surgery, or having a tooth pulled. Web15 nov. 2024 · Living with hemophilia A means that you need to recognize bleeding problems. In many instances, bleeding from a cut or a wound will be visibly apparent. You might not feel pain associated with bleeding, so you should check your skin whenever you have any injuries. In Cureus, Rayas and colleagues presented the case report of a patient with untreated aplastic anemia who was later diagnosed with classical paroxysmal nocturnal hemoglobinuria (PNH). Aplastic anemia is characterized by bone marrow failure, leading to pancytopenia (including anemia). It is a rare and life-threatening disease. WebHemophilia A.
